On Wednesday night at 1 am, Sage woke me up crying like I’ve never heard before. I picked him up and he was light, hardly breathing, and not looking well. We rushed him to the nearest Veterinary hospital as soon as we could. While waiting for him, the doctor repeatedly told us he may not make it through the night. His heart rate dropped all the way down to 40 and they were doing all they could to save his life. Thankfully, his heart rate and blood pressure continued to rise over the 3 days he was in the hospital. Even after all the tests, we still don’t have an actual answer as to what caused this to happen to our baby boy, and he has many tests and checkups still to come.
